小程序JavaScript万年历源码开放下载

版权申诉
0 下载量 80 浏览量 更新于2024-11-20 收藏 17KB RAR 举报
资源摘要信息:"小程序 JavaScript万年历(源码).rar" 知识点概述: 1. 小程序概念与特性 2. JavaScript在小程序中的应用 3. 万年历算法原理 4. 互联网版权与免责声明解读 1. 小程序概念与特性 小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序是一种新的连接用户与服务的方式,它具有以下几个特性: - 即用即走:用户无需安装卸载,使用后可立即退出,不占用手机存储空间。 - 弱网络依赖:部分小程序在无网络环境下依然可以使用,适合离线使用场景。 - 安全性能高:小程序具有较为严格的代码审核机制,保护用户隐私安全。 - 开发便捷:小程序提供了一套简洁的开发框架,开发者可以快速上手,降低开发门槛。 2. JavaScript在小程序中的应用 JavaScript是小程序开发中最核心的编程语言,它用于实现小程序的逻辑处理、数据绑定、页面渲染等功能。小程序中的JavaScript与传统Web前端开发中的JavaScript在很多方面都是一致的,但也有部分差异,主要表现在: - API不同:小程序提供了专为移动端设计的API接口,例如获取用户信息、支付、数据缓存等。 - 模块化:小程序支持ES6的import/export模块化编程方式,方便管理大型项目中的代码结构。 - 组件化:小程序使用JSON配置文件定义页面的结构、样式和逻辑,将界面划分为多个可复用的组件。 - 运行环境:小程序的JavaScript运行在微信或其他平台提供的内置环境中,与浏览器环境有所区别。 3. 万年历算法原理 万年历是指能表示任意年月日星期的历表,其算法核心在于解决日期计算和星期判定问题。万年历算法通常需要考虑以下几个关键因素: - 闰年判断:根据格里高利历的规则,能被4整除但不能被100整除的年份,或能被400整除的年份为闰年。 - 月份天数:大多数月份的天数是固定的,例如一月、三月、五月等31天,四月、六月等30天。二月因闰年与否天数有所不同。 - 日期计算:确定某一天是该月的第几天,或者确定某年某月某日是星期几。 - 星期换算:常用的有Zeller公式或蔡勒公式,用于计算公历日期对应的星期。 4. 互联网版权与免责声明解读 互联网内容的版权问题是每个网络用户都应该了解的基本常识。在本资源中提到的免责声明,反映了内容提供者在互联网版权意识方面的认识。具体内容包括: - 资料来源:声明资料部分来源于合法的互联网渠道收集整理,部分为个人学习积累的成果。 - 使用目的:资料仅供学习参考与交流使用,不应用于商业目的。 - 费用说明:收取的费用仅用于资料收集和整理耗费的时间报酬。 - 版权尊重:声明尊重原创作者或出版方的版权,资料归作者所有,不承担相关法律责任。 - 违规处理:对于资料中可能存在的版权问题或不当内容,提供举报机制,一旦发现将及时删除相关内容。 综上所述,本资源“小程序 JavaScript万年历(源码).rar”是一份关于小程序开发的实践案例,涉及JavaScript编程、万年历算法实现以及互联网版权知识。开发者可以通过学习此资源中的源码,深入理解小程序的开发原理和实现方法,同时也需要对互联网内容的版权问题保持警觉和尊重。